loosens

[US]/ˈluːsənz/
[UK]/ˈlusənz/
Frequency: Very High

Translation

v.to make something less tight or firm; to relax something; to untie or free from restraint

Example Sentences

the massage loosens tight muscles.

she loosens her grip on the steering wheel.

he loosens the screws to adjust the frame.

the teacher loosens the rules for the project.

yoga loosens the body and calms the mind.

the heat loosens the adhesive on the tape.

she loosens her hair after a long day.

the coach loosens the training schedule for the team.

the drink loosens his inhibitions.

he loosens the tie after the meeting.
